Single Pitch Award Overview

This award trains and assesses candidates in the skills required to supervise climbers on single pitch crags and climbing walls. Common activities undertaken by an SPA holder will be roped climbing and bouldering. The SPA does not include the skills and techniques required to teach lead climbing.

Single Pitch Award Registration
To register you should have a genuine interest in rock climbing and the supervision of
groups on single pitch crags. You should have at least twelve months rock climbing
experience and be at least eighteen years of age. You should also be an individual or club member of a mountaineering council.
Registration cost is £39 per award

The number of organised groups enjoying rock climbing and abseiling on outcrops,
crags, quarries and climbing walls has multiplied in recent years. MLT is concerned that
high standards of supervision are maintained, so that both enjoyment and safety are
enhanced, without compromising either the sport of climbing or the participation of
other crag or wall users. High standards of supervision and organisation are best
achieved through experience, personal qualities, training and validation.
This scheme has been designed to provide a level of basic competence for those who
are in a position of responsibility during single pitch rock climbing activities. Whilst the award does include some elements of personal competence it is not designed as a
measure of such. It should not be used as either an entry requirement or measure of
suitability for individuals who wish to climb on climbing walls or crags.
